Calmerry is a trusted online therapy platform founded in 2020 as a response to the growing need for mental health support during lockdown. The primary goal was to fight the stigma around mental health issues and make therapy easily accessible for everyone from any device. Since then, Calmerry has already helped thousands of clients to improve their mental well-being. Today, the mission that drives us is to make mental health care an integrative part of people’s lives and their daily routines. ?? There are 1,000+ mental health professionals on our platform, experienced in treating various problems and concerns, including depression, anxiety, low self-esteem, relationship issues, grief, trauma, and burnout. To support clients' mental wellness further, we provide the Self-care digital toolbox – with mood-tracking and journaling tools and educational content to build their awareness and help grow mental health skills. Supporting mental health in small businesses doesn't require a big budget—it starts with small, meaningful steps. When teams wear multiple hats and resources are limited, even simple actions can make a significant difference: ? Create space for mental health breaks – A five-minute breather between tasks can help reduce stress and improve focus. ? Foster open conversations – When we normalize discussions about mental health, from casual check-ins to team conversations, we build stronger, more supportive workplaces. ? Embrace flexibility – Small adjustments like occasional remote work or flexible hours can help team members better manage their work-life balance. ? Share wellness resources – There are many free educational resources and self-care techniques that teams can benefit from together. ? Lead by example – When leaders prioritize their well-being, employees feel empowered to do the same. Small actions create a ripple effect. Remember: Building a mentally healthy workplace is a journey of small, consistent steps that add up to meaningful change.
